Corn has been in a dead dog market since harvest with export rationing prices, but not high enough to ration domestic use to the extent needed. Several price breaks down as low as $7.05 Dec.Which gave endusers a reasonable point to get coverage. We had 2 bullish reports on september stocks report and oct monthly usda that saw prices surge then fail. November report was as expected with bearish beans unable to pull corn lower. Enough time has now gone by since harvest rush to give endusers reason to start coming to the plate soon,but with heavy selling at harvest this could stay flat another week but I dought it . Corn is heading higher into Jan report | |
